The 38th anniversary of the establishment of the Turkish Republic of Northern Cyprus was celebrated with much jubilation on Monday.
Ceremonies were realised at the mausoleum of the late Turkish Cypriot leader Dr. Fazıl Küçük’s mausoleum and at the TMT Monument due to ongoing construction of the mausoleum of the late founding President Rauf Raif Denktaş.
The first ceremony on Monday was realized in front of the Lefkoşa Martyrs’ Monument.
A second ceremony was held at the Atatürk Monument and this was followed by the main parade at the Dr Fazıl Küçük Boulevard.
Addressing the public during the ceremony here, President Ersin Tatar said that the Turkish Cypriot people experienced one of their most joyous days on the 15th of November 1983 and that the anniversary of the TRNC, which was founded with an honourable struggle for existence and unmatched sacrifices, was celebrated with great enthusiasm.
Noting that while experiencing such happiness and in order to take concrete steps towards the future, the past experiences of the Turkish Cypriot people needed to be evaluated correctly, Tatar said there is a need to progress on the path of the national struggle without being hindered.
“If we as the Turkish Cypriot people are able to live freely in our own homeland with our heads held high and in honour, we owe this to the heroic people, to the martyrs, veterans and our national heroes Dr. Fazıl Küçük and Rauf Raif and to Motherland Turkey who paid every price without hesitation” said Tatar.
Explaining that the Greek Cypriot side is calling for a return to the Republic of Cyprus, where it has usurped the rights of the Turkish Cypriot people, Tatar said that the Greek Cypriot side is dreaming of assimilating the Turkish Cypriot people in time.
“It is due to this dream that they have rejected every recommendation put forth during the negotiations process that has continued for 53 years. They also rejected the Annan plan. The process that started in 2008 collapsed in Crans Montana in July 2017 because the Greek Cypriot side refused equality and continued to demand a solution where there are zero soldiers, zero guarantees and called for a solution that would turn Cyprus into a Greek speaking state under Greek rule” said Tatar.
He stated that the ground for a federation, which has been maintained for years in the Cyprus negotiation has been exhausted and added that a negotiations process will not be entered without the acceptance of sovereign equality and equal political status of the Turkish Cypriot side.
Noting that a just and sustainable solution in Cyprus can be achieved through the acceptance of the existing two states on the island and the sovereign equality of these two sides, Tatar said “as the elected president of the Turkish Cypriot people, instead of stepping into new problems and an uncertain future in Cyprus, we have opened the door of a new era with our new vision that can produce solutions to the problems around the island”.
Explaining that with the support of Motherland Turkey the Turkish Republic of Northern Cyprus will exist forever, Tatar thanked Turkish President Recep Tayyip Erdoğan on behalf of the Turkish Cypriot people for his support
Touching upon the Maraş opening, Tatar said that the opening had created a new dimension on the Cyprus issue and added that Maraş is the Turkish Cypriot sides. Maraş is under our sovereignty and part of the territory of the Turkish Republic of Northern Cyprus.
Touching upon the critical developments taking place in the Eastern Mediterranean, Tatar said that a struggle has begun for the hydrocarbon resources in the area and that there are forces that are trying to remove Turkey’s rights in the area.
Noting that tensions are high in the area due to the Greek-Greek Cypriot duo, Tatar said that any initiative that excludes Turkey and the TRNC from the Eastern Mediterranean has no chance for success.
Also noting that the legitimate rights of Turkey and the Turkish Cypriot people will be defended to the end Tatar stated that the Turkish Republic of Northern Cyprus will exist forever.
